Basic information Safety Related Supplier
10-butyl-10H-phenothiazine-3-carbaldehyde 5-oxide Structure

10-butyl-10H-phenothiazine-3-carbaldehyde 5-oxide

10-butyl-10H-phenothiazine-3-carbaldehyde 5-oxide Supplier